Figure 1 and Table 2 show the external components that are needed for the RF430FRL152H to operate.
Figure 1. RF430FRL15xH Application Circuit | Name | Value | Description | Comment |
|---|---|---|---|
| C4 | 10 nF | Charge pump capacitor | Needed for proper device operation |
| C5 | 100 nF | Decoupling cap at VDD2X | Needed for proper device operation |
| C7 | 1 µF | Bypass capacitor between SVSS and VSS | For proper ADC operation |
| C6 | 10 nF | Decoupling cap at RST | To prevent noise and unintentional resets |
| C2 | 2.2 µF | Decoupling cap at VDDSW | Power supply decoupling |
| C8 | 100 nF | Decoupling cap at VDD | Digital logic decoupling |
| C9 | 100 nF | Decoupling cap at VDDH | Power supply decoupling |
| C3 | 100 nF | Decoupling cap at VDDB (if a battery is being used) | To reduce ESR on a battery |
When using the ROM library, as with the "Default" and "SensorHub" examples, some external resistors may be necessary. See Table 3 for specifics. If using the "NFC" example, this section does not apply.
| Pin | Value | Description | Comment |
|---|---|---|---|
| 19 (P1.7) | 10 kΩ to 100 kΩ |
Pullup: External host controller Pulldown: Digital sensor used |
If neither host controller nor digital sensor is used, then use a pullup. Also this pin can be reused for JTAG. |
| 20 (P1.6) | 10 kΩ to 100 kΩ |
I2C address set bit 1 of I2C address SPI mode: sets the SPI Mode (1-4) |
Necessary only if host controller mode is being used. Is a don't care when digital sensor mode is used. Also this pin can be reused for JTAG. |
| 21 (P1.5) | 10 kΩ to 100 kΩ |
I2C mode: set bit 0 of I2C address SPI mode: sets the SPI Mode (1-4) |
Necessary only if host controller mode is being used. Is a don't care when digital sensor mode is used. Also this pin can be reused for JTAG. |
| 8 (P1.3) | Tie to GND or float |
Tie low to enable I2C slave functionality for host controller. High or floating on start-up enables SPI functionality for host controller. |
Necessary only if host controller mode is being used. Is a don't care when digital sensor mode is used. |
For more information, see the section on interfacing a host controller in the RF430FRL15xH firmware user's guide.
